Try the command "ip ospf flood-reduction". It is similar to the demand
circuit feature and also sets the LSA's to not age.

Sorry for this one, maybe I'm thinking to much this morning, but here we go,
could I set the DNA Bit in a P2P PPP interface using OSPF as the interface
routing protocol :P?, Ok from my understanding is that the DNA bit is used
to support Demand Circuits, but is there any other way to set this??? IMHO
I think that It's not so illogic having a standby operation in a
Point-2-Point Link.
